title = "Dual-band dielectric rod antenna for satellite communication system",
abstract = "In this paper, we have simulated the dielectric rod antenna by using CST microwave studio which is commercially available simulator based on finite integral technique for satellite communication system. We emphasize particularly, on the gain of the proposed antenna at two frequencies that is from 25GHz to 35 GHz. The radiation mechanism of the dielectric rod antenna is based on the discontinuity radiation concept in which the antenna is regarded as an array composed of two effective sources at the feed end and free end of the rod.",
